Graph y= - x - 6 on a graph

Mathematics
2 answers:
iogann1982 [59]4 years ago
5 0

Answer:

(Picture below)

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ve this you will first need to make a coordinate plane that is 10 by 10.

After you have done that you will need to know what slope intercept form is. Slope intercept form is y=mx+b and the equation that was given was y=-x-6. In the formula y=mx+b, m is the slope or rise over run and b is where the line crosses the y axis.

Now that you know the basics of slope intercept form we can start graphing. so b in this equation is -6, so we will put the first point on -6. after we have done that we can start putting the points of the line. So since the slope is just -1x  we will have to go down one and go to the right one about 3 times and just to finish it up go up and left on 3 times to. And there you have it.

For what value of x will the line passing through the points A(x+14, 5) and B(2−3x, 8) be vertical?
trapecia [35]

Answer:

x=-3

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The slope of a vertical line is undefined

The formula to calculate the slope between two points is equal to

m=\frac{y2-y1}{x2-x1}

we have

A(x+14, 5) and B(2−3x, 8)

substitute

m=\frac{8-5}{(2-3x)-(x+14)}

m=\frac{3}{2-3x-x-14}

m=\frac{3}{-4x-12}

so

If the slope is undefined

then

The denominator must be equal to zero

-4x-12=0

solve for x

4x=-12\\x=-3
